METALON
6 PLA (Natural Ivory
, Black) Unmodified cast nylon 6 grade exhibiting characteristics which come very close to those of METALON 66 SA. It combines high strength, stiffness and hardness with good creep and wear resistance, heat ageing properties and machinability. METALON
6 XAU+ (Black) METALON
6 XAU+ is a heat stabilised cast nylon grade with a very dense and highly
crystalline structure. Compared with conventional extruded or cast nylons,
METALON 6 XAU+ offers superior heat ageing performance in air (much better
resistance to thermal-oxidative degradation), allowing 15 30 °C
higher continuously allowable service temperatures. METALON 6 XAU+ is
particularly recommended for bearings and other mechanical parts subject
to wear which are operating in air for long periods of time at temperatures
over 60 °C. METALON
OILON-GOLD (Olive
Green) This
internally lubricated cast nylon 6 is self-lubricating in the real meaning
of the word. METALON OILON, especially developed for unlubricated, highly
loaded and slow moving parts applications, yields a considerable enlargement
of the application possibilities of nylons. This is because of its reduced
coefficient of friction (up to 50 %) and improved wear resistance (up
to x 10). METALON
MC 901 (Blue) This modified cast nylon 6 grade with its distinctive blue colour exhibits higher toughness, flexibility and fatigue resistance than METALON 6 PLA. It has proved to be an excellent material for gear wheels, racks and pinions. METALON
GSM (Grey-Black) METALON
GSM contains finely divided particles of Molybdenum Disulphide to enhance
its bearing and wear behaviour without impairing the impact and fatigue
resistance inherent to unmodified cast nylon grades. It is a very commonly
used grades for gears, bearings, sprockets and sheaves. METALON
NSM (Grey)
METALON NSM is a proprietary cast nylon 6 formulation containing solid lubricant additives which grant this material self-lubricity, excellent frictional properties, superior wear resistance and outstanding Pressure-Velocity capabilities (up to 5 times higher than conventional cast nylons). Being particularly suited for higher velocity, unlubricated moving parts applications, it is the perfect complement to the oil-filled grade METALON OILON.

Within the polyamides, commonly referred to as Nylons, we distinguish different types. The most important ones are: PA 6 and PA 66. The differences in physical properties which exist between these types are mainly determined by the composition and the structure of their molecular chains.) |
